Tsonglaknyi festival celebrated in Meriema

Kohima, October 12 (MExN): "Culture and Tradition are made by God not by man, and if it is lost everything is lost." Adviser for Printing and Stationary, H Haiying said this during the celebration of Tsonglaknyi festival at IG Stadium Meriema on October 12. While stating that Naga culture and tradition are unique, he also urged the gathering to respect other cultures and traditions. He said the festival was a time to forgive and forget, and let peace and prosperity prevail in “our land,” while adding that success and progress come through sincerity, humility and hard work. As per a DIPR report, the programme was chaired by T Asuthong, Treasurer TUK. Folk song "O ha ha ha Tsonglak akii" was presented by Kiuti Khia Tsinrechip, while significance of Tsonglakni was shared by TL Kiusiimong, executive member TUK. A short speech was given by Topan, Tikhir Tribal President (TTC) and James Tikhir, President TUK and vote of thanks was delivered by Khiungakiu S Tikhir.

 

NSCN (IM) mourns demise of  Deputy Kilonser Khaiyar

Hebron, October 12 (MExN): The NSCN (IM) today mourned by the untimely demise of Pengmayong A Khaiyar, Deputy Kilonser, GPRN from Longpi village under Wung Tangkhul Region (WTR) on October 12. In a condolence message issued by MIP, it stated that Khaiyar enrolled in the Naga national service in 1986. He left behind his wife and son. “He served the Naga nation with unwavering national spirit until his demise. The void created by his demise would be difficult to fill in. For his selfless contribution to the Naga national cause, his name shall be recorded in the pages of Naga history and his sacrifices ever be cherished by all,” the message read. At this hour of sorrow, GPRN conveyed its deep condolences to the bereaved family members and prayed that the Almighty God grant his soul eternal peace and rest.

Excise Dept seizes drugs worth around 9 lakh

Dimapur, October 12 (MExN): In a major haul of Narcotic drugs, the Narcotic Cell (NC) of the Excise Department, Nagaland seized a total of 5,800 bottles of Codeine cough syrup (LU cough) on October 11 at the Excise Check Gate, Chümoukedima at around 1:00 pm. Based on suspicion, the Excise Narcotic Cell duty party intercepted a Bolero pick–up mini-truck with Assam registration number, and on frisking recovered the drugs concealed below packaged drinking water bottles. In this connection, two accused persons – Sunny Malakar, 27 years and Tapan Deb, 30 years, both residents of Bokajan, Assam, were arrested. As per a press release from Deputy Commissioner of Excise (NC), S Chanlei Angh, on initial interrogation, both the accused admitted that they were trafficking drugs from Khakhati, Assam to Kohima. The apprehendees were booked under relevant sections of the NDPS Act 1985 and forwarded to judiciary for further trial. The value of the seized drugs were estimated to be around Rs 9 lakh.
